ABSTRACT:
If you have an existing investment in a legacy phone system, it may seem at first glance that you are not in a position to embrace VoIP. However, there are a number of solutions that can leverage an existing phone system, while providing the benefits of VoIP. The benefits of migrating to VoIP are significant. Careful planning is critical to make the migration a success. This paper will review the essential considerations, service offerings and tactical recommendations on how to address each of these for a successful transition to a VoIP solution.
